Tale as old as time: I'm a recent grad who is new to the world of apartment renting, and there's this post on Facebook caught my eye. Now I'm aware that scammers exist (crazy, I know), so I'm already operating with that age-old "if it looks too good to be true, it probably is" philosophy when scouring these listings.
Anyways, here's the listing details:
"Hello everyone I have a 1b/1b and a private studio apartment for rent well and fully furnished $800 monthly safe neighborhood parking yes available brand new appliances pet friendly and month to month lease accepted walkable distance to the campus also available for workers kindly send me a Dm for more info.
Thank you…"
--------------------------
My reasons for suspecting this is some sort of AI scam:
One: all that for $800 a month?
Two: the chair at the kitchen table is sandwiched against the wall.
Three: there are a couple moments where the camera "walks" backwards in a suspiciously not-human way, instead of...y'know... just turning around.
---------------------------
Are there any other things I missed? The desperate part of me wants this to be real, but enough warning bells are going off in my head to think it isn't. Any input would help, and I'd be happy to share more info if necessary!

The knitting community of reddit seems convinced that this is AI. I see why the lighting and editing makes it look AI, but as a knitter myself I find all their reasons to be completely plausible in the context of a human-made albeit staged picture. I don‘t see any typical indicators for AI like undefined or warped objects and for example the knit fabric looks very real to me instead of doing the weird AI thing were patterns get messed up.
Have I missed a crucial development and improvement in AI tech, where it can easily fake these things now?
Edit: she‘s not supposed to be actively knitting in this. The resolution is a little messed up here but in the original pic she is picking at a stitch marker and assumedly removing it. And I would assume that AI would generate a picture of someone actively knitting if prompted to do an ad for knitting products
